We followed the BHC H1743-322/IGR J17464-3213 (ATels #1348,#1349,#1352) with Swift/XRT during the decreasing phase of the outburst until quiescence for a total amount of 20 ks (in 6 pointings). The observations were performed two times per week from 2008 February 12th at 01:31:00 UT until March 5 13:19:18 UT. The source flux decreasing along the observing period occurred with a constant spectral shape, namely an absorbed power-law.
